Default m4a music files on a web site - how do I get them to play?

Hi all,

On my retail site I want to add 2 music files. - We are running an ad campaign on local radio. They have supplied the adverts to me in a .m4a format. -

I want users of the web site to be able to play one of these files if they want to hear the ad. How do I add them to the site and do I need to convert them to anything???
